John Irving (footballer, born 1867)
John Irving (1867 – 20 November 1942), also known as Johnnie or Johnny Irving, was a Scottish professional association footballer who scored 10 goals from 51 appearances in the Football League in the 1890s playing as an inside right for Lincoln City.
